Canada has suspended 30 permits for arms sales to Israel and cancelled a contract with a US company to sell Quebec-made ammunition to the Israeli army, Foreign Affairs Minister Melanie Joly said. Joly was emphatic that the government will not allow Canadian-made ammunition, in this case, manufactured by the Canadian arm of US-based General Dynamics, to be sold or shipped to other countries for resale to Israel.
